- Salsabila RamadaniJan 18, 2025 · a year agoEstoppel is a legal principle that prevents a person from asserting a claim or defense that is inconsistent with their previous statements or actions. In the context of the cryptocurrency market, estoppel can affect the legal status of digital assets by limiting the ability of individuals or entities to dispute ownership or transfer of these assets based on their previous representations or conduct. For example, if someone has previously represented themselves as the owner of a specific digital asset and has engaged in transactions involving that asset, they may be estopped from later claiming that they do not own it. This can provide a level of certainty and protection for parties involved in cryptocurrency transactions.
